Re: [PSES] ESD protection for USB 3.0

2015-02-02 Thread Brian Oconnell
Just finished with a box having USB port - what a pain.  Test, testing, and yet 
more tests are the only way to go.

Lotsa stuff and papers from TI, On semi, TE, Littelfuse, etc. If you are very 
lucky, and the space aliens do interfere, you may be able to find a FAE that 
actually knows this stuff and can save you from making poor layout and 
component selection decisions. That is, the physical construction of your box 
can be just as important as the TVS that is incorporated. Lotsa luck.
